Nancy Sexton

Birth29 Nov 1863 - Scott, Tennessee, United States
Death10 October 1933 - Chattanooga, Hamilton, Tennessee
MotherMary Magdeline Stewart
FatherFielding Sexton

Born in Scott, Tennessee, United States on 29 Nov 1863 to Fielding Sexton and Mary Magdeline Stewart. Nancy Sexton married Charles Isaac Taylor and had 7 children. She passed away on 10 October 1933 in Chattanooga, Hamilton, Tennessee.
